Tejas Anilkumar P.

Hello, I am Tejas, a passionate self-starter electrical and computer engineer with experience in Electrical and Embedded System Design as well as Computer RTL Design, and a forever love for electronics and robotics.
Areas of Interest: VLSI RTL Design, Digital Design, ASIC Design, SoC Design, PCB Design, Embedded System Design, Internet of Things, Microcontrollers, Robotics and UAVs, Electric Vehicles.


Experience

Carnegie Mellon Robotics Institute

Graduate Research Assistant

Moon Ranger Rover Project (CMU and NASA)
Video Link
• Wi-Fi Subsystem Lead, worked on designing the communication between rover and lander.
• Implemented Wireless File Transfer over TCP sockets, modified as an API.
• Implemented Wireless Joystick control of rover in ROS (Nvidia Jetson TX2i + Spacely Board)
• Designed GUI in PyQt5 for command and control of Rover wirelessly.
• Demonstrated Serial IP protocol on TI Hercules board.
• Involved in Thermal and Radiation testing of components.

May 2020 - December 2020

IntelliTech Systems

Founder

Startup based on IOT Home Automation
Video Link
• Designed a REST API based Node JS Server and Android App acting as control panel. ESP8266 Microcontroller (Relay control unit) receives command from app and triggers switching of the relay of respective appliance accordingly.
• Integrated IFTTT, a third-party service was used for providing voice control feature via Amazon Alexa or Google Assistant via Webhooks.
• Designed 2-layer PCB for the Relay control unit.

December 2017 - December 2019

Education

Carnegie Mellon University

Master of Science
Electrical and Computer Engineering

GPA: 3.79 / 4.00

January 2020 - May 2021

University of Mumbai - Dwarkadas J. Sanghvi College of Engineering

Bachelor of Engineering
Electronics Engineering

GPA: 8.75 / 10.00

May 2014 - July 2017

MSBTE - Thakur Polytechnic

Diploma
Electronics Engineering

Percentage: 85.83%

May 2011 - March 2014

Projects

Computer Engineering Projects

Fastbit Neural Network (Spring 2021)
Advanced Digital Integrated Circuit Design Group Project (Group of 4)
• Wrote the Verilog code for Memory Control logic and testbench for Fingerprint Scanner and Hard Disk Drive (HDD) Data Detection Channel.
• Helped in debugging the RTL-to-GDSII flow to obtain the final chip in Cadence software with TSMC PDK.

Greatest Common Divisor Chip Design (Spring 2021)
Advanced Digital Integrated Circuit Design Project
• Wrote the Verilog code for Datapath and Control logic.
• Performed RTL-to-GDSII flow to obtain the final chip in Cadence software.

16-bit Processor Design with Iterative Multiplication (Fall 2020)
Digital Integrated Circuit Design Project
• Designed the Layout and Schematics for the 16-bit register file (using SRAM 6T cell).
• Wrote the assembly code for 8bit multiplication.
• Debugged the Verilog code for the 16-bit processor successfully.

Transimpedance Amplifier Design (Fall 2020)
Analog Integrated Circuit Design Group Project-I (Group of 2)
• Helped in the design of Schematics for Transimpedance Amplifier and calculated the Hand Analysis for Transimpedance Amplifier Design

Operational Amplifier Design (Fall 2020)
Analog Integrated Circuit Design Group Project-II (Group of 2)
• Designed the Layout of the Operational Amplifier and helped in the design of Schematics and Hand Analysis.

Electrical and Computer Science Projects

Arduino based board PCB Design (2021) Link
• Designed a 2-layer PCB board based on Arduino Microcontroller.

Machine Learning Course (10-601) Projects (Spring 2020)
• Designed Decision Trees, Hidden Markov Model, Neural Network, Logistic Regression and Reinforcement Learning Agent for Mountain Car Problem.

Virtual Mouse control using OpenCV (2018)
• Wrote a virtual mouse control using OpenCV library in Python.
• Mouse functions can be performed using different colors.

Quadcopter Design (2017) Video Link
• Designed quadcopter using KK V2.0 board with wiring of ESC and power supply.

Wall Climbing Surveillance Bot (2017) Video Link 1 Video Link 2
Undergraduate Final Year Project
• Designed Wall Climbing bot based on Differential Pressure mechanism which produces vacuum using an Electric Ducted Fan and designed a webpage to control it.
• Used an IP camera to access the surveillance feed.

IOT + Voice Recognition based Home Automation (2017) Video Link
• Designed an MQTT based IOT system with MQTT Server provided by Adafruit for IOT Control of Appliances using ESP8266(MQTT Client)
• Integrated Alexa Voice Engine for Voice Recognition on Raspberry Pi 3, connected to Adafruit MQTT Server for voice control of appliances.

GSM Based Motor Control (2017)
• Designed an GSM based system for 1.5HP motor controlled by call or SMS.
• Improved security of the system by allowing control of the motor only from recognized mobile number.

Gesture Controlled Bot (2016)
• Designed a bot control system based on Accelerometer ADXL335 and Flex Sensor
• Designed an Android App to utilize Mobile phone’s accelerometer for control of the bot via Bluetooth HC-05.

Bluetooth Home Automation (2016)
• Designed a bluetooth home automation system using Arduino + Bluetooth HC-05
• Designed an Android App for pairing the Mobile phone’s bluetooth to the control unit for switching the appliance's state.

Skills

Programming Languages & Tools

• C / C++
• Python
• Embedded C
• C#

• Verilog
• Cadence Software
• Assembly
• TCL

• Shell Scripting
• Java
• SQL/SQLite
• Node.js

• Altium
• Arduino
• Android Studio
• Visual Studio

• Git
• Linux
• Robot Operating System
• OpenCV

• MS Office
• TensorFlow
• WordPress
• FreeRTOS

Hardware

• PCB Designing
• Soldering
• Digital Oscilloscope
• Digital Multimeter

• Embedded System Design
• Raspberry Pi
• Nvidia Jetson TX2
• Arduino Board

• ESP8266 Wi-Fi Board
• TI CC3200 Wi-Fi Board
• ARM FRDM Board
• AVR Microcontroller

• Solar On-grid Installation
• Solar Off-grid Installation
• Bluetooth HC-05
• LIDAR

...and the curiosity and belief to learn even more to achieve my target.

Coursework

Graduate Level

• Digital Integrated Circuit Design (18-622)
• Advanced Digital Integrated Circuit Design (18-725)
• Machine Learning (10-601)
• Analog Integrated Circuit Design (18-623)
• Fundamentals of Semiconductor Devices (18-310)
• Space Robotics (16-865)
• Computer Vision (16-720)
• Corporate Startup Lab (45-996)

Undergraduate Level

• Digital Circuit and Design
• Basic VLSI Design
• CMOS VLSI Design
• Embedded System Design
• Computer Architecture
• Microprocessor and Microcontroller
• Object Oriented Programming
• Analog Circuit Design
• Electronic Devices
• Circuit Theory
• Digital Image Processing
• Biomedical Electronics

Certifications and Awards

• Quadcopter and RC Aircraft (2017) Link
• Microsoft Technology Associate - Security Fundamentals (2016) Link
• Best Student of the Year Award - Diploma (2014)

Interests

Apart from being a Electrical and Computer engineer, I enjoy most of my time DIY-ing electronics and robotics projects, playing video games and trying out new recipes in cooking (Not a professional 😅).

I 💗 sci-fi and thriller genre movies and television shows, and I spend a lot of my time exploring the latest technology advancements in electronics and robotics.